The 2009 Chelsea Flower Show
Foreign & Colonial Investments' Garden: silver medal
With some of the largest trees ever seen at the Show, this bog garden is dominated by these swamp cypresses, and features carnivorous pitcher plants. Rust and yellow aquilegia echoes the reddish hue of the wood. Designed by Thomas Hoblyn. The wooden waves are made from a redwood tree felled by a storm; much else of the gardens' material is recycled. After the show, the garden will be reconstructed in Suffolk.
